support use of prebuilt bootable images
authorDoug Zongker <dougz@android.com>
Wed, 26 Jan 2011 01:03:34 +0000 (17:03 -0800)
committerDoug Zongker <dougz@android.com>
Wed, 26 Jan 2011 01:07:09 +0000 (17:07 -0800)
img_from_target_files now, with the -z flag, will produce an output
zip with only the bootable partitions (boot and recovery).

img_ and ota_from_target_files can take, instead of a simple
"target_files.zip", a name of the form
"target_files.zip+bootable_images.zip", where the second zip contains
bootable images that should be used instead of building them from the
target_files.zip.  (This should be the zip produced by the above -z
flag, perhaps with the images messed with in some way, such as by an
unnamed OEM's extra signature wrapper for their "secure boot"
process.)
